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(4149)

Unified Diff: cc/test/solid_color_content_layer_client.h

Issue 1960543002: Optimize render passes with single quads (Closed) Base URL: https://chromium.googlesource.com/chromium/src.git@master
Patch Set: Fix context menus Created 4 years, 6 months 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View side-by-side diff with in-line comments
Download patch
Index: cc/test/solid_color_content_layer_client.h
diff --git a/cc/test/solid_color_content_layer_client.h b/cc/test/solid_color_content_layer_client.h
index d765f94d346d7986d40daa6b84115b7bbbb067f2..d8fcd70c48a8500b2404ae359692073ca07f2db0 100644
--- a/cc/test/solid_color_content_layer_client.h
+++ b/cc/test/solid_color_content_layer_client.h
@@ -16,7 +16,15 @@ namespace cc {
class SolidColorContentLayerClient : public ContentLayerClient {
public:
explicit SolidColorContentLayerClient(SkColor color, gfx::Size size)
- : color_(color), size_(size) {}
+ : color_(color), size_(size), border_size_(0), border_color_(0) {}
+ explicit SolidColorContentLayerClient(SkColor color,
+ gfx::Size size,
+ int border_size,
+ SkColor border_color)
+ : color_(color),
+ size_(size),
+ border_size_(border_size),
+ border_color_(border_color) {}
gfx::Rect PaintableRegion() override;
@@ -29,6 +37,8 @@ class SolidColorContentLayerClient : public ContentLayerClient {
private:
SkColor color_;
gfx::Size size_;
+ int border_size_;
+ SkColor border_color_;
};
} // namespace cc

Powered by Google App Engine
This is Rietveld 408576698